Abstract
The utility model provides a kind of toilet ventilation system, including the ventilation blower for performing toilet and extraneous ventilation, its architectural feature is, in addition to sensing methane concentration device, concentration of hydrogen sulfide sensor, humidity sensor and the controller being installed in toilet;Controller includes MCU, air-blower control execution module and power module;Each sensor electrically connects with MCU;Air-blower control execution module electrically connects with MCU;Ventilation blower electrically connects with air-blower control execution module;Power module provides working power.The utility model is simple in construction, and cost is relatively low, it is easy to accomplish, its when in use can automatic detection toilet air parameter and accordingly control ventilation blower work, toilet can be made effectively to keep with fresh air and proper moisture, the effectively save electric energy of and can.

Embodiment
The utility model is described in further detail with reference to the accompanying drawings and detailed description.
(Embodiment 1)
See Fig. 1, the toilet ventilation system of the present embodiment, its main sensing methane concentration by being installed in toilet
Device, concentration of hydrogen sulfide sensor, humidity sensor, controller and ventilation blower composition;Controller is mainly held by MCU, air-blower control
Row module and power module composition.
Sensing methane concentration device, cause the methane gas of one of the Main Ingredients and Appearance of toilet air peculiar smell dense for monitoring
Degree;Sensing methane concentration device electrically connects with the MCU of controller, by the toilet Methane in Air gas concentration number of detection during use
The MCU of controller is uploaded to when factually.
Concentration of hydrogen sulfide sensor, the hydrogen sulfide gas of one of the Main Ingredients and Appearance of toilet air peculiar smell is caused for monitoring
Concentration;Concentration of hydrogen sulfide sensor electrically connects with the MCU of controller, by the toilet Air Hydrogen Sulfide gas of detection during use
Concentration data is uploaded to the MCU of controller in real time.
Humidity sensor, for monitoring toilet air humidity;Humidity sensor electrically connects with the MCU of controller, uses
When the toilet air humidity data of detection are uploaded to the MCU of controller in real time.
The MCU of controller, for receiving the real time detection signal of each sensor upload and being carried out with built-in judgment threshold
Multilevel iudge accordingly sends control instruction fan control execution module, and controls ventilation blower work by air-blower control execution module
Make or stop.
The air-blower control execution module of controller, for performing MCU instruction, it is corresponding control ventilation blower work or stop with
And run during control ventilation blower work with one grade or second speed;Air-blower control execution module electrically connects with MCU.Air-blower control is held
Row module is adjustable speed fan control module common in the art, is not detailed.
The power module of controller, for providing working power;Power module is provided with power input, the first power supply exports
End and second source output end, the first power output end of power module electrically connect with MCU;The second source output of power module
End electrically connects with air-blower control execution module, in use, the power input termination toilet AC220V civil powers of power module.
Ventilation blower, for performing toilet and extraneous ventilation;Ventilation blower electrically connects with air-blower control execution module;
In the present embodiment, ventilation blower preferably uses two grades of adjustable speed blower fans.
(Application examples)
The toilet ventilation system of previous embodiment, its when in use, methane concentration first judges built in the MCU of controller
Threshold value J1 and the second judgment threshold of methane concentration J2, concentration of hydrogen sulfide the first judgment threshold L1 and concentration of hydrogen sulfide second judge threshold
Value L2, air humidity the first judgment threshold S1 and the second judgment threshold of air humidity S2;Its method of work such as following steps:
1. sensing methane concentration device and concentration of hydrogen sulfide sensor detection toilet Methane in Air and vulcanization in real time respectively
Hydrogen gas concentration;Humidity sensor detects toilet air humidity in real time;Detection data are uploaded to control by each sensor in real time
The MCU of device;
2. MCU receive the real-time detector data that each sensor uploads and in real time with its built in threshold value judgement is compared:
If real-time the second judgment threshold of the detected value < methane concentrations J2 of the first judgment threshold of methane concentration J1≤methane concentration,
Then perform step 3.;If real-time the second judgment threshold of the detected value >=methane concentration J2 of methane concentration, step is performed 4.;
If the real-time detected value < concentration of hydrogen sulfide second of the first judgment threshold of concentration of hydrogen sulfide L1≤concentration of hydrogen sulfide judges
Threshold value L2, then perform step 3.;If real-time the second judgment threshold of the detected value >=concentration of hydrogen sulfide L2 of concentration of hydrogen sulfide, performs step
Suddenly 4.;
If real-time the second judgment threshold of the detected value < air humiditys S2 of the first judgment threshold of air humidity S1≤air humidity,
Then perform step 3.;If real-time the second judgment threshold of the detected value >=air humidity S2 of air humidity, step is performed 4.;
If meet simultaneously:Real-time the first judgment threshold of the detected value < methane concentrations J1 of methane concentration, concentration of hydrogen sulfide are real-time
Detected value < the first judgment thresholds of concentration of hydrogen sulfide L1, real-time the first judgment threshold of the detected value < air humiditys S1 of air humidity,
Then perform step 5.;
3. MCU starts ventilation blower with one grade of operation work by air-blower control execution module;
4. MCU controls ventilation blower with two grades of operation work by air-blower control execution module;
5. MCU controls ventilation blower to be stopped by air-blower control execution module.
